  1. Decide the catalog size

Prior to designing your catalog or estimating the cost of printing, you must establish the catalog size. A catalog's size depends on the products your business sells. Having a small catalog is not necessary for jewelry and watches since they are small enough. Small catalogs are also unable to handle large home appliances such as refrigerators and washing machines. Here are some suggestions for keeping track of catalog sizes:

 

· 5.5” x 8.5” — These catalogues are thin and tall, which is ideal for displaying product images and short descriptions. Catalogs of this size are usually used for small products such as cameras and bracelets.

 

· 6” x 6” or 6” x 9” — These catalogs come in rectangles or squares, and their product lines often feature a small selection of features.

 

· 8.5" x 11" or 9" x 12" - These sizes are ideal for fashion and accessories catalogs.

 

· 12" x 12" - This is the largest available size for catalogs, which are suitable for displaying larger appliances such as televisions and electric washers.

  1. Proper Product Descriptions 

Each product in your printed catalog must have an accurate and appropriate description. The requirement applies to all products in your catalog, regardless of category. You must explain to a potential customer why they should buy a product. Besides describing the product features, the description should also include the value proposition. A good product description will generate sales. Before you begin writing your product descriptions, make sure all the key specifications are in place.

  1. Apt Product Information 

After you have written all the product descriptions, you can move on to the product information. Descriptions of products are crucial to a catalog. Details about the product should be included in the product information. Product details should include a product name, the item number, a category, a price, and features.

  1. Add an Order Form 

Adding a product catalog to your business will increase sales. Without an order form, a catalog does not serve its purpose. Your customers will be able to order directly from your catalog if you include an order form. When creating an order form, you should keep these things in mind:

  • Provide sections for customers to place multiple orders

  • Include a section for the shipping address

  • Give a large choice for payment options

  • Lastly, there must be a page that contains the number and name of the customer 

  1. Proofread the Catalog

The printing company needs your catalogue design for this step. Once the design is complete, proofread and check it. Make sure you haven't made any spelling or grammatical mistakes in your essay. Additionally, make sure that all pictures, product numbers, descriptions, and prices are correct after you've finished printing. As soon as all errors have been corrected, you should send your catalog to be printed.

Catalogue era 

In the days before the internet and the history of catalogs was just beginning, companies used printed catalogs to present their products to customers. Sending the catalog, ordering, and shipping all took place through the mail.

Catalogs were delivered to customers' mailboxes, they picked the items they wanted and sent their mail order along with payment for the items and shipping. In the following days or even weeks, the products were delivered by post.

Catalogs like these aren't much different from those we have today. Although some brands still use mail orders successfully, the buyers usually place their orders by telephone or online.
